Block
#13,328,271
8w
7 txs266,377 confs
Transactions
7
Total Output
₳10,323.18
$1.53K
Fees
₳1.98
Size
8.15 KB
8,349 bytes
Details
Hash
ed5d04c3214a7b252389df7b9be36df41f62317582c6b9a4e5f4a301410012f7
Epoch / Slot
Epoch 626 · slot 185,381,510 · epoch-slot 312,710
Timestamp
8w · Thu, 23 Apr 2026 12:36:41 GMT
Block producer
VRF key
vrf_vk1d…zq3wsmhv
Op cert
fefeee54…954fe108
Op cert counter
7